What Makes a Strong Sample of Good Character Letter? Key Elements and Tips
A good character letter can make a significant impact when it comes to vouching for someone’s credibility, integrity, and overall character. Whether it’s for a job application, college admission, or legal purposes, a well-written character letter can greatly influence the decision-making process. But what exactly makes a strong sample of good character letter? In this article, we will explore the key elements and provide you with valuable tips to create an impactful character letter.
Introduction: Establish Your Relationship
The introduction of a good character letter should clearly establish your relationship with the person you are writing about. Begin by stating your name and how you know the individual in question. This helps the reader understand the context and credibility behind your testimonial.
For example, if you are writing a character letter for an employee, mention how long you have worked together or in what capacity you have interacted with them. If it’s for a personal reference, explain your relationship with the person – whether they are a friend, neighbor, or family member.
Highlight Positive Traits and Examples
After establishing your relationship in the introduction, proceed to highlight the positive traits of the person you are recommending. Focus on qualities that are relevant to their intended purpose or situation.
For instance, if they are applying for a job that requires excellent teamwork skills, provide specific examples of times when they have demonstrated effective collaboration in previous roles or projects. If they are seeking admission to a university known for its strong leadership program, highlight instances where they have shown exceptional leadership abilities.
Remember to be specific and provide concrete examples whenever possible. Generic statements without supporting evidence may not carry as much weight.
Address any Weaknesses Honestly
While it’s important to accentuate positive qualities in a character letter, it is equally crucial to address any weaknesses honestly. This not only shows sincerity but also demonstrates your objective assessment of the person’s character.
However, it’s essential to strike a balance between highlighting weaknesses and emphasizing their positive attributes. Instead of dwelling on flaws, focus on how the person has worked to overcome them or how they have grown as an individual.
For example, if the person tends to be shy and reserved, mention how they have actively participated in public speaking workshops to improve their confidence. This shows that they are self-aware and proactive in personal development.
Conclusion: Summarize and Offer Contact Information
In the conclusion of a good character letter, summarize your main points by reiterating the positive traits you highlighted earlier. This helps reinforce your recommendation and leaves a lasting impression on the reader.
Additionally, provide your contact information at the end of the letter. This allows the recipient to reach out to you for further clarification or verification if needed. Make sure to include your phone number and email address for easy accessibility.
